    Gateway™ ATR Electrically Heated Trough Top Plate Data Sheet For Zinc Selenide General Toxic and hard, yellow coloured crystalline powder when fused together as a solid can be used as a transmission window material or as a crystal material for attenuated total reflectance (ATR) FTIR spectroscopy. Insoluble in water, but attacked by strong acids and bases.

    User Manual Data Sheet For Germanium General Hard and very brittle material, but can be shaped, cut and polished to form spectral transmission window or crystal for ATR spectroscopy. Because of its high Refractive Index value suffers from large reflection losses but these can be improved with antireflection optical coatings Is temperature sensitive and loses transmission when heated.

    Gateway™ ATR Electrically Heated Trough Top Plate Data Sheet For Silicon General Synonyms: Defoamer S-10. When powder is fused together, is used as a transmission window material. Very hard, but brittle and relatively inert material. Insoluble in water, resists acids and bases but is attacked by combination of hydrofluoric and nitric acid. Can withstand thermal shock.
